Description

Sunny Upper Unit Near Downtown & BART Available Now!

Welcome to 1537 Woolsey Street a bright and inviting upper unit in a charming 2-plex, perfectly located for convenience and comfort in Berkeley.

This spacious apartment is filled with natural light and features beautiful hardwood floors throughout, giving it a warm and classic feel. The kitchen comes equipped with a gas stove and refrigerator, making meal prep easy and efficient. The bathroom includes a full tub/shower combination for your comfort. New instant hot water heater.

Enjoy shared outdoor space in the garden perfect for relaxing or getting some fresh air. Additional amenities include shared laundry on-site and street parking available with a permit.
